About Sateesh Krishnamurthy

Sateesh Krishnamurthy is a scholar working on Epidemiology, Molecular Biology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Infectious Diseases and Genetics, having authored 20 papers that have together received 1.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Virology and Viral Diseases (9 papers), Respiratory viral infections research (7 papers), RNA Interference and Gene Delivery (5 papers), Virus-based gene therapy research (4 papers), Advanced biosensing and bioanalysis techniques (3 papers), Cystic Fibrosis Research Advances (2 papers), Viral gastroenteritis research and epidemiology (2 papers) and HIV Research and Treatment (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Animal Science and Zoology (245 citations), Epidemiology (702 citations), Infectious Diseases (350 citations), Genetics (280 citations) and Virology (42 citations). Sateesh Krishnamurthy has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Italy and Japan. Frequent co-authors include Siba K. Samal, Zhuhui Huang, Aruna Panda, Toru Takimoto, Allen Portner, Ruth Ann Scroggs, Paul B. McCray, Christine Wohlford-Lenane, Julia L. Hurwitz and Xiaoyan Zhan.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Virology, Molecular Therapy — Nucleic Acids, Vaccine, Virology and Nature Communications.
